The postcode OX14 1BB is located in Vale of White Horse, in the county of Oxfordsh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. OX14 1BB is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

OX14 1BB is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 8.4 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of OX14 1BB as Suburbanites > Suburban achievers > Ageing in suburbia.

The closest road name to OX14 1BB is Westfields which is centered 167 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Larkmead School and is 132 m away. The closest railway station is Radley Rail Station, 4.06 km away.

The closest primary school to OX14 1BB (for ages 11 and under) is The Manor Preparatory School.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Larkmead School. The last OFSTED inspection on January 15, 2019 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of OX14 1BB is Abingdon Royal British Legion Club and is 621 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on June 2, 2015. The nearest takeaway food is available from McDonalds and is 633 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on August 23,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 136.2 Mbps and an average upload speed of 17 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 3 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.5 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for OX14 1BB is covered by the Thames Valley police force association and Oxfordsh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
